A pair of fine 19th-century gilt and patinated bronze (ormolu) ornamental candlesticks executed in the Regency style. Each piece features a central foliate-cast stem terminating in a tulip-form nozzle with leaf-moulded rims. The base of each stem is encircled by three gracefully modelled swans finished with a dark chemical patination. The tripartite bases are heavily decorated with neoclassical and rocaille elements, including large scallop shells and acanthus scrolls, all supported by three shell-form feet. The items exhibit high-quality casting with fine chased details throughout. The modular construction is secured to the underside with modern-style nuts, washers, and wingnuts, indicating later professional assembly or restoration. Dimensions: Height 25cm, Base Width 15cm. Weight: 1.8kg per candlestick.
